Web Based Double-Hand Strategy


The greatest online Double-hand Poker method would be to take benefit of the gambler’s choice of being the banker. Initially, the dealer will start the game out as the banker, but as it progresses, every player is given the opportunity to act as the banker. You might choose to either except or deny you are your method, but the most important controllable factor will be in balancing out your time spent as the gambler versus your time spent as the banker.

Like every single other table game in the world, it was created to favor the baker, and unlike Black jack, Double-hand poker offers the gambler the chance to take benefit of the game’s biased nature. Sadly, like everything else that has to do with any betting house, this selection comes as a price. The price tag of getting the banker is often a five % commission incurred on all winning banked bets. Interestingly enough, when a gambler is acting as the banker, the casino croupier will become a gambler wagering the casino’s money against the player. In this situation, the gambling den usually limits their gambler gamble to the size of the gambler’s last gamble before he becomes the banker.

The game of Double-hand Poker is completely researched, and also a basic strategy invented to develop almost certainly the most favorable situations for the player, and give him the most effective possibility of beating the bank. The initial thing you ought to do must familiarize yourself with all of the published information, and learn the game’s basic technique for playing a specific hand. When calculating the odds of the player generating both a winning high and low hand to beat the croupier, we can se that this must occur twenty eight point six percent of the time. Respectively, the banker will win both hands 29.9 % of the time, and also a push will occur forty one point four eight % of the time. Since you cannot wager on the push, the next logical approach could be to get as much action as you possibly can when you are the banker. Granted, there is a five % commission charged on all winnings obtained as the banker, but in the end, the odds are still in the banker’s favor.
